• 제목/요약/키워드: Complexity System

검색결과 3,518건 처리시간 0.029초

Anti-Jamming GPS 시스템을 위한 적응형 디지털 신호 처리에 관한 분석 (Analysis of Adaptive Digital Signal Processing for Anti-Jamming GPS System)

  • 한정수;김석중;김현도;최형진;김기윤
    • 한국통신학회논문지
    • /
    • 제32권8C호
    • /
    • pp.745-757
    • /
    • 2007
  • 본 논문에서는 GPS 수신기로 유입되는 간섭 및 재밍 신호를 효율적으로 제거 또는 억압하기 위해 배열 안테나(way antenna)를 적용한 항 재밍(anti-jamming) GPS 시스템을 설계하고 운용 방안을 제시하였다. 특히 제안하는 안테나 구조 및 운용 방안은 전통적인 6 원형 배열 안테나(6 circular array antenna) 구조에서 중앙에 1개의 소자를 추가한 7 배열 원형 안테나 구조로써 주어진 간섭 및 재밍 환경 하에서 전력 효율적으로 운용된다. 아울러 적응형 배열 안테나를 사용하여 디지털 신호처리를 수행할 경우 성능이 우수한 것으로 잘 알려진 STAP(Space Time Adaptive Process)와 SFAP(Space Frequency Adaptive Process)를 적용하고 두 방식의 구조 및 복잡도에 관한 분석, 그리고 동일한 복잡도(Complexity) 조건에서 다양한 재밍 환경에서의 BER 성능 비교를 수행하였다.

객체지향 역공학을 위한 소프트웨어 복잡도 측정 기법 (A Software Complexity Measurement Technique for Object-Oriented Reverse Engineering)

  • 김종완;황종선
    • 한국정보과학회논문지:소프트웨어및응용
    • /
    • 제32권9호
    • /
    • pp.847-852
    • /
    • 2005
  • 지난 10여년간 객체지향 코드의 관리 및 분석을 위해 객체지향 소프트웨어 시스템에 대한 다양한 복잡도 계산 기법들이 제안되었다. 이러한 기법들은 WMC(Weighted Methods per Class), LCOM(Lack of Cohesion in Methods)과 같이 소스코드 분석을 기반으로 한다. 기존 기법들의 한계는 코드에서 함수의 개수만 계산한다는 것이다. 본 논문에서는 함수의 파라메타 개수, 반환값 여부 그리고 자료형까지도 확인하는 새로운 가중치 기법을 제안하며, 이를 역공학에 적용한다. 또한 역공학과정에서 객체지향 코드를 위한 클래스 복잡도 계산 지침을 제공하기 위해 인터페이스에 가중치를 부여하는 효율적인 복잡도 측정 기법을 제안한다. 제안기법인 ECC(Enhanced Class Complexity)는 C++ 환경에서 일관성 있고 정확한 결과를 보여준다.

확장된 근사 알고리즘을 이용한 조합 방법 (Rule of Combination Using Expanded Approximation Algorithm)

  • 문원식
    • 디지털산업정보학회논문지
    • /
    • 제9권3호
    • /
    • pp.21-30
    • /
    • 2013
  • Powell-Miller theory is a good method to express or treat incorrect information. But it has limitation that requires too much time to apply to actual situation because computational complexity increases in exponential and functional way. Accordingly, there have been several attempts to reduce computational complexity but side effect followed - certainty factor fell. This study suggested expanded Approximation Algorithm. Expanded Approximation Algorithm is a method to consider both smallest supersets and largest subsets to expand basic space into a space including inverse set and to reduce Approximation error. By using expanded Approximation Algorithm suggested in the study, basic probability assignment function value of subsets was alloted and added to basic probability assignment function value of sets related to the subsets. This made subsets newly created become Approximation more efficiently. As a result, it could be known that certain function value which is based on basic probability assignment function is closely near actual optimal result. And certainty in correctness can be obtained while computational complexity could be reduced. by using Algorithm suggested in the study, exact information necessary for a system can be obtained.

모형의 복잡성, 구조 및 목적함수가 모형 검정에 미치는 영향 (Effects of Model Complexity, Structure and Objective Function on Calibration Process)

  • Choi, Kyung Sook
    • 한국농공학회지
    • /
    • 제45권4호
    • /
    • pp.89-97
    • /
    • 2003
  • Using inference models developed for estimation of the parameters necessary to implement the Runoff Block of the Stormwater Management Model (SWMM), a number of alternative inference scenarios were developed to assess the influence of inference model complexity and structure on the calibration of the catchment modelling system. These inference models varied from the assumption of a spatially invariant value (catchment average) to spatially variable with each subcatchment having its own unique values. Fur-thermore, the influence of different measures of deviation between the recorded information and simulation predictions were considered. The results of these investigations indicate that the model performance is more influenced by model structure than complexity, and control parameter values are very much dependent on objective function selected as this factor was the most influential for both the initial estimates and the final results.

시계열 데이타의 흔돈도 분석 알고리즘에 관한 연구 (A Study on Complexity Measure Algorithm of Time Series Data)

  • 이병채;정기삼;이명호
    • 대한의용생체공학회:학술대회논문집
    • /
    • 대한의용생체공학회 1995년도 춘계학술대회
    • /
    • pp.281-284
    • /
    • 1995
  • This paper describes a complexity measure algorithm based on nonlinear dynamics(chaos theory). In order to quantify complexity or regularity of biomedical signal, this paper proposed fractal dimension-1 and fractal dimension-2 algorithm with digital filter. Approximate entropy algorithm which measure a system regularity are also compared. In this paper investigate what we quantify of biomedical signal. These quantified complexity measure may be a useful information about human physiology.

  • PDF

객체지향 분석 단계에서의 클래스 복잡도 측정 (Measurement of Classes Complexity in the Object-Oriented Analysis Phase)

  • 김유경;박재년
    • 한국정보과학회논문지:소프트웨어및응용
    • /
    • 제28권10호
    • /
    • pp.720-731
    • /
    • 2001
  • 구조적 개발 방법론에 적용하도록 만들어진 복잡도 척도들을 클래스의 상속성, 다형성, 메시지 전달 그리고 캡슐화와 같은 객체지향의 개념에 직접적으로 적용할 수 없다. 또한 기존의 객체지향 소프트웨어에 대한 척도의 연구는 프로그램의 복잡도나, 설계 단계의 척도가 대부분이었다. 실제로 분석단계 클래스의 복잡도를 낮춤으로서 시스템의 개발 노력이나 비용 및 유지보수 단계에서의 노력이 크게 줄어들게 되므로, 분석 클래스에 대한 복잡도를 측량하기 위한 척도가 필요하다. 본 논문에서는 객체지향 개발방법론인 RUP(Rational Unified Process)의 분석 단계에서 추출되는 분석 클래스에 대해서 복잡도를 측정할 수 있는 새로운 척도를 제안한다. 협력 복잡도CC(Collaboration Complexity)는 가능한 협력의 최대 수로서 클래스가 잠재적으로 얼마나 복잡할 수 있는지를 측정하기 위한 척도이며, 각 협력자들의 인터페이스를 이해하는 것과 관련된 총체적 어려움을 측정하는 인터페이스 복잡도 IC(Interface Complexity)를 정의하였다. 제안된 척도는 Weyuker의 9가지 공리적 성질에 대하여 이론적인 검증을 하였으며, 텍스트 마이닝 기법을 사용하여 사용자의 질문에 자동으로 응답하는 시스템의 분석 클래스에 대하여 제안된 척도를 적용하여 복잡도를 측정하였다. 제안된 CC와 IC의 값과 Chidamber와 Kemerer가 제안된 CBO와 WMC의 값을 비교해 본 결과, 제안된 복잡도 척도의 계산결과 값이 큰 클래스의 경우에는 설계 이후 단계에서도 역시 복잡도가 커지게 되는 것을 알 수 있었다. 이로써 소프트웨어개발 주기의 초기에 클래스에 대한 복잡도를 평가해 보고, 나머지 단계에 필요한 시간과 노력을 예측함으로써 보다 비용-효과적인 객체지향 소프트웨어를 개발할 수 있는 가능성이 높아질 것으로 기대된다.

  • PDF

효율적인 에러 정정을 위한 콘케티네이티드 코팅 시스템 (Concatenated Coding System for an Effective Error Correction)

  • 강법주;강창언
    • 대한전자공학회논문지
    • /
    • 제23권3호
    • /
    • pp.309-316
    • /
    • 1986
  • A concatenated coding system using a binary code as the inner code and a nonbinary code as the outer code has been constructed for the purpose of error correction. The complexity of a conventional coding system grows exponentially as the code length of a block code becomes longer. To reduce the complexity for ling code, an effective communication system has been proposed by cascading two codes-binary and norbinary codes. Using a parallel-to-serial circuit and a serial-to-parallel circuit, the concatenated coding system has been designed and constructed by empolying a (7,3) burst error correcting code as the inner code and a (7,3) Reed-Solomon code as the outer code. This system has been simulated and tested using a micro-computer. For the (49,9) concatenated coding system, the error probability of the channel has been evaluated and compared to different coding systems.

  • PDF

예측주기를 이용한 트랜스코딩 기반의 스트리밍 시스템 (A Streaming System based on Transcoding using the Prediction Period)

  • 김성민;김현희;박시용;정기동
    • 한국정보과학회논문지:소프트웨어및응용
    • /
    • 제33권10호
    • /
    • pp.823-835
    • /
    • 2006
  • 멀티미디어 서비스가 전체 인터넷의 많은 부분을 차지하고 있으며, 계속해서 관심이 증가되고 있다. 네트워크가 다양해지고 구성 단말들의 종류도 다양해짐에 따라, 획일적인 컨텐츠로 멀티미디어 서비스를 하는 것이 불가능해졌다. 각 단말별 요구도 다양해지고, 네트워크의 대역폭도 다양해짐에 따라서 적응적인 서비스가 요구된다. 비디오 트랜스코딩은 멀티미디어 데이타를 적응성 있게 서비스할 수 있는 좋은 방법이다. 본 논문은 멀티미디어 데이타를 스트리밍 하기 위해 부호기, 트랜스코더, 복호기로 구성된 시스템을 제안한다. 부호기는 예측 주기를 이용하여 트랜스코딩할 경우의 계산 복잡도 및 PSNR을 향상시켰고, 복호기는 일반적인 미디어 재생기와 거의 유사하다. 트랜스코더에서는 부호기의 예측주기와 프레임율을 조절하는 삭제주기를 통해서 효율적인 계산 과정을 선택한다. 실험 결과, 기존의 트랜스코더와 부호기, 복호기를 이용한 시스템에 비해서 본 논문에서 제안한 시스템이 계산복잡도와 PSNR에서 높게 나타났다.

대용량 악성코드의 특징 추출 가속화를 위한 분산 처리 시스템 설계 및 구현 (Distributed Processing System Design and Implementation for Feature Extraction from Large-Scale Malicious Code)

  • 이현종;어성율;황두성
    • 정보처리학회논문지:컴퓨터 및 통신 시스템
    • /
    • 제8권2호
    • /
    • pp.35-40
    • /
    • 2019
  • 기존 악성코드 탐지는 다형성 또는 난독화 기법이 적용된 변종 악성코드 탐지에 취약하다. 기계학습 알고리즘은 악성코드에 내재된 패턴을 학습시켜 유사 행위 탐지가 가능해 기존 탐지 방법을 대체할 수 있다. 시간에 따라 변화하는 악성코드 패턴을 학습시키기 위해 지속적으로 데이터를 수집해야한다. 그러나 대용량 악성코드 파일의 저장 및 처리 과정은 높은 공간과 시간 복잡도가 수반된다. 이 논문에서는 공간 복잡도를 완화하고 처리 시간을 가속화하기 위해 HDFS 기반 분산 처리 시스템을 설계한다. 분산 처리 시스템을 이용해 2-gram 특징과 필터링 기준에 따른 API 특징 2개, APICFG 특징을 추출하고 앙상블 학습 모델의 일반화 성능을 비교했다. 실험 결과로 특징 추출의 시간 복잡도는 컴퓨터 한 대의 처리 시간과 비교했을 때 약 3.75배 속도가 개선되었으며, 공간 복잡도는 약 5배의 효율성을 보였다. 특징 별 분류 성능을 비교했을 때 2-gram 특징이 가장 우수했으나 훈련 데이터 차원이 높아 학습 시간이 오래 소요되었다.

Performance of Multicarrier-CDMA Uplink with Antenna Arrays and Multiuser Detection

  • Sigdel, Shreeram;Ahmed, Kazi M.;Fernando, Anil
    • Journal of Communications and Networks
    • /
    • 제5권2호
    • /
    • pp.150-156
    • /
    • 2003
  • In this paper, an uplink MC-CDMA system incorporating multiuser detection and smart antennas has been considered. The performance of asynchronous as well as synchronous system is studied over a correlated Rayleigh multipath slow fading channel. A simplified array-processing algorithm suitable for slow fading situation is investigated to overcome the heavy computational complexity associated with Eigen solutions. The effect of variable data rate in the system performance is considered and effectiveness of antenna array to handle high data rate is discussed. A brief investigation on the system performance degradation due to correlated channel is also carried out. Based on the extensive simulation carried out, the performance of the asynchronous uplink system is found dramatically improved with antenna array and multiuser detection. Asynchronicity and channel correlation are found to affect the system performance significantly. The investigated simpli- fied algorithm produces similar results as Eigen solutions in slow fading situation with much reduced complexity.